description The study aim was an assessment of the risk of damage to the health of the population of an industrial city due to air pollution by atmospheric emissions from a mining and technical company. Materials and methods. The volume of maximum permissible emissions of a mining and technical company was used in the work. The assessment of the distribution and impact of atmospheric emissions was carried out at 30 calculated points selected on the basis of a map of the city of Novokuznetsk, the Kemerovo Region. The maximum and average annual concentrations of pollutants were calculated. The risk values of chronic intoxication and carcinogenic risk, hazard coefficients and indices were determined. The obtained risk values were compared with acceptable levels. Risk values were determined taking into account the background concentrations of substances. Results. Exceeding the maximum and average annual concentrations of pollutants was not detected at all impact points. The total risk levels of chronic intoxication ranged from 0.00004 to 0.001, not exceeding the acceptable level (0.02). The highest value of the total level of risk of chronic intoxication (0.001) was found in the micro-district located closer to the sources of exposure. The main contribution to the formation of the risk level was made by inorganic dust with a content of SiO2 < 20 %, nitrogen dioxide and sulfur dioxide. The total risk levels of chronic intoxication, taking into account background exposure to pollutants, were in the range from 0.052 to 0.073, significantly exceeding the acceptable level. The largest specific weight of pollutants in the risk of chronic intoxication, taking into account the background, was observed in nitrogen dioxide and carbon monoxide. The hazard indices for chronic inhalation exposures for all substances, taking into account the background, exceeded one, therefore, there was the impact on the body. The calculated levels of carcinogenic risk did not exceed the acceptable level, both without taking into account the background impact of pollutants, and with regards to the background. Conclusion. Mining and technical company activities make a certain contribution to air pollution in Novokuznetsk, without causing significant damage to public health. High risk levels of chronic intoxication and hazard indices, calculated taking into account the background exposure to pollutants, are due to the general unfavorable situation in the city.
